#1d94d2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1d94d2 is composed of 11.4% red, 58% green and 82.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 86.2% cyan, 29.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 17.6% black. It has a hue angle of 200.6 degrees, a saturation of 75.7% and a lightness of 46.9%. #1d94d2 color hex could be obtained by blending #3affff with #0029a5. Closest websafe color is: #3399cc.

#1d94d2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1d94d2 has RGB values of R:29, G:148, B:210 and CMYK values of C:0.86, M:0.3, Y:0,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 1938642.

Shades and Tints of #1d94d2
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000203 is the darkest color, while #f1f9f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#1d94d2
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#707a7f is the less saturated color, while #019dee is the most saturated one.
